Chilham station, although unstaffed, offers essential conveniences for travelers. The station doesn't have a ticket office, but rest assured, there are ticket machines available for purchasing and collecting tickets. These machines are conveniently located on the station's forecourt and are accessible for all passengers. Additionally, an induction loop is provided for those with hearing impairments.
While the station is equipped with seating areas, it falls short of offering waiting rooms or refreshment facilities. Toilets, including accessible ones, and baby changing areas are not available, so plan accordingly. Despite these limitations, passengers traveling on this route appreciate the efficiency and reliability of its services.
Chilham station offers partial step-free access, specifically to platform 2 for services traveling away from London. Unfortunately, platform 1, servicing trains towards London, only has step access, making it less accessible for those with mobility concerns. There's a ramp available for train access, and on-train staff are ready to assist passengers upon request.
Given that the station is unstaffed, passengers in need can rely on customer help points for communication with assistance teams. These are strategically placed on the platform, ensuring you can arrange for additional support if necessary. A mobile assistance team can also be dispatched when booked in advance.

Gainsborough Lea Road does not have a ticket office, but fret not, as ticket machines are at your convenience for on-the-go purchases. While it's worth noting that there's no option to collect pre-purchased online tickets, the station provides an induction loop for those in need. Accessibility-wise, it features step-free access to certain parts of the station. On-train staff are available to provide ramps, ensuring ease of access in parts. Please bear in mind that tactile paving is present only at the edge of platform 2.
In terms of comfort, the station is quite basic. There are no waiting rooms, shops, or refreshment facilities—potentially ideal for the minimalist traveller. Without ATM machines or currency exchange facilities, it emphasizes the need to come prepared with your essentials. CCTV cameras are in place for security, along with free 24-hour car parking managed by East Midlands Railway, boasting 12 spaces. However, those requiring accessible parking further afield might need to consider alternatives.
Getting to your final destination from Gainsborough Lea Road is fairly straightforward. Situated near a main road, Rail Replacement Services can be accessed right adjacent to the station. For those needing taxis, 24-hour service options are available from local companies such as Daves or Colins.
